Overview
Advancements in technology continue to drive innovation in rugged computing and switches used in the aerospace and defense industry. These advancements demand a significant increase in bandwidth to support various critical applications and interfaces further complicated by the need for small, form factor LRU interconnect solutions. We’ll dive into some factors driving this need, discuss high-speed, just-in-time networking and low-latency data transfer in bandwidth-intensive scenarios and finally how our innovative D38999 connector family can help alleviate your interconnect challenges.
At PIC Wire & Cable, we've designed our MACHFORCE D-38999 connector family for current and future high-speed electronic systems within the aerospace and defense markets. Our MACHFORCE connector integrates several features that make it relevant for next generation sophisticated electronics including: direct PCB integration, small interconnect footprint, the opportunity to leverage multiple disconnects while maintaining signal integrity, simplified termination with industry-standard contacts and direct access to terminated pins for field repairs. With these features, it's easy to see how MACHFORCE connectors are the ideal solution for advancing interconnect capabilities within the aerospace and defense markets.
